The Aries, a 93 foot ketch, arrived in Woods Hole in March of 1959 as a gift from R.J. Reynolds. She was refitted as a research vessel by June and was then used continuously on current measuring cruises off Bermuda as part of a joint project shared by WHOI and the British National Institute of Oceanography until August 1960.
